How to Automate bank reconciliation on Mac

Bank reconciliation requires methodically comparing transactions, matching entries, categorizing expenses, and ensuring your books balance—tedious work that follows the same pattern every month. ClickMimic automates these repetitive steps, helping accountants and bookkeepers reconcile accounts faster while reducing the risk of manual errors.

20 minutes
Setup time
medium
Difficulty
0
Lines of code

Step-by-Step Guide

  1. 1

    Download ClickMimic

    Visit clickmimic.app/download and download the Mac app. Install it by dragging to your Applications folder.

  2. 2

    Open and Click Record

    Launch ClickMimic and click the Record button. The app will start capturing your mouse clicks and keystrokes.

  3. 3

    Perform Your Bank Reconciliation Task

    Matching bank transactions with accounting records ClickMimic will record every action automatically.

  4. 4

    Stop and Save

    Click Stop when you're done. Give your macro a descriptive name and save it.

  5. 5

    Replay Anytime

    Click Play to replay your automation. Use the scheduler for hands-free operation at specific times.

Benefits of Automating Bank Reconciliation

  • Faster month-end close
  • Catch discrepancies early
  • Reduce manual matching

Who Uses This Automation

Prerequisites

Before you start, make sure you have:

  • A Mac running macOS 12 (Monterey) or later
  • ClickMimic installed (download here)
  • Your accounting software (QuickBooks, Xero, FreshBooks, Wave, etc.) and bank access

Tips for Reliable Bank Reconciliation Automation

  • Download statements first: Start with all bank statements downloaded and saved to a consistent folder location.
  • Create category-specific macros: Build separate workflows for common transaction types to speed up categorization.
  • Include verification steps: Add pauses to review matched transactions before confirming reconciliation.
  • Process chronologically: Work through transactions in date order for easier tracking and audit trails.

Frequently Asked Questions

Can I automate bank reconciliation across different applications?

Yes! ClickMimic records all your actions across any Mac applications. Download from your bank's website, import into QuickBooks, and update your spreadsheet—all automated.

What if the interface changes?

ClickMimic uses smart detection that adapts to minor UI changes. Banking dashboards may require occasional updates after major redesigns.

Can I schedule this automation?

Yes! ClickMimic includes a built-in scheduler for running automations at specific times—ideal for daily transaction imports or weekly reconciliation sessions.

How do I handle transactions that don't match automatically?

Create a macro for the matching workflow that processes standard matches. Flag exceptions for manual review at the end of your automated session.

Can it work with multiple bank accounts?

Yes! Create separate macros for each bank account, or build a comprehensive workflow that processes all accounts in sequence during your reconciliation session.

Automate this workflow on macOS

Record mouse and keyboard actions, schedule replays, and run no-code automations with ClickMimic.